Not sure if this was covered on here or not, but I seem to remember some folks were trying to find hexes to allow the use of 12mm hex wheels. I'm in the process of building an XB4 and I would really like to be able to do this too. I have heaps of Caster wheels which I really need to be able to use.
Came across these on HK.
http://www.hobbyking.com/hobbyking/s...12mm_Hex_.html
These are available in Blue, Purple, Red and Titanium and in 4, 5, 6 & 7mm thicknesses. It is a 5mm hole and they would appear to be identical 12mm versions of Xray's 14mm hexes. And they are cheap!
Only downside is that they aren't in stock in the UK, so delivery could be slow.

I don't think the shock caps have been available yet. Superior should have most of the parts, that's where I got my drive shafts.
For the hexs use the 1654 Traxxas hexs, $2 and work like a charm. They're plastic but when they start to wear just get some new ones. They also snap onto the cross pin so they don't fall off every time you change wheels.

I'm about 90% sure that the Serpent hexes are too narrow in the back, although they're about spot on in the front.
I haven't tried those Traxxas hexes yet, but they're only a solution to the rear. They'll be far too wide in the front. Although I haven't measured it yet, so don't take it for fact, I believe Serpent front and Traxxas rear are extremely close.
